Serengeti National Park

Established in 1951 and designated as the World Heritage Site in 1981. It is the biggest national park in Tanzania covering an area of 14,763 square km of its endless plains. Serengeti Plains support the herds of more than one million wildebeests migrating from Masai Mara across Grumeti River through Ndutu Plains to the Ngorongoro Crater every year. Serengeti National Park is about 355km (208 miles) north-west of Arusha town.
